Martin Barr is a scholar working on Pharmacology, Analytical Chemistry and Organic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Martin Barr has authored 27 papers receiving a total of 362 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Pharmacology, 4 papers in Analytical Chemistry and 3 papers in Organic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Martin Barr’s work include Plant-based Medicinal Research (6 papers), Analytical Methods in Pharmaceuticals (4 papers) and Clay minerals and soil interactions (3 papers). Martin Barr is often cited by papers focused on Plant-based Medicinal Research (6 papers), Analytical Methods in Pharmaceuticals (4 papers) and Clay minerals and soil interactions (3 papers). Martin Barr coll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Vietnam. Martin Barr's co-authors include G Rossi, Michael J. Drews, M. Williams, Michael King, T. R. Bott, Philippa Ward and Jennifer Hill and has published in prestigious journals such as Industrial & Engineering Chemistry Research, Journal of Pharmaceutical Sciences and Journal of Marketing Management.

Rankless uses publication and citation data sourced from OpenAlex, an open and comprehensive bibliographic database. While OpenAlex provides broad and valuable coverage of the global research landscape, it—like all bibliographic datasets—has inherent limitations. These include incomplete records, variations in author disambiguation, differences in journal indexing, and delays in data updates. As a result, some metrics and network relationships displayed in Rankless may not fully capture the entirety of a scholar’s output or impact.
